8336 - shesh

Strong's Concordance

Original word: שֵׁשׁ
Transliteration: shesh
Definition (short): linen
Definition (full): bleached stuff, white linen, marble

NAS Exhaustive Concordance

Word Origin: of foreign origin
Definition: byssus
NASB Translation: fine linen (16), fine...linen (21), finely...linen (1).

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

Or (for alliteration with meshiy) shshiy {shesh-ee'}; for shayish; bleached stuff, i.e. White linen or (by analogy) marble -- X blue, fine ((twined)) linen, marble, silk.
